IMAGEHLP_SYMBOL_TYPE_INFO enumeration (dbghelp.h)
Identifies the type of symbol information to be retrieved.
Syntax
typedef enum _IMAGEHLP_SYMBOL_TYPE_INFO {
TI_GET_SYMTAG,
TI_GET_SYMNAME,
TI_GET_LENGTH,
TI_GET_TYPE,
TI_GET_TYPEID,
TI_GET_BASETYPE,
TI_GET_ARRAYINDEXTYPEID,
TI_FINDCHILDREN,
TI_GET_DATAKIND,
TI_GET_ADDRESSOFFSET,
TI_GET_OFFSET,
TI_GET_VALUE,
TI_GET_COUNT,
TI_GET_CHILDRENCOUNT,
TI_GET_BITPOSITION,
TI_GET_VIRTUALBASECLASS,
TI_GET_VIRTUALTABLESHAPEID,
TI_GET_VIRTUALBASEPOINTEROFFSET,
TI_GET_CLASSPARENTID,
TI_GET_NESTED,
TI_GET_SYMINDEX,
TI_GET_LEXICALPARENT,
TI_GET_ADDRESS,
TI_GET_THISADJUST,
TI_GET_UDTKIND,
TI_IS_EQUIV_TO,
TI_GET_CALLING_CONVENTION,
TI_IS_CLOSE_EQUIV_TO,
TI_GTIEX_REQS_VALID,
TI_GET_VIRTUALBASEOFFSET,
TI_GET_VIRTUALBASEDISPINDEX,
TI_GET_IS_REFERENCE,
TI_GET_INDIRECTVIRTUALBASECLASS,
TI_GET_VIRTUALBASETABLETYPE,
TI_GET_OBJECTPOINTERTYPE,
IMAGEHLP_SYMBOL_TYPE_INFO_MAX
} IMAGEHLP_SYMBOL_TYPE_INFO;
Constants
TI_GET_SYMTAG The symbol tag. The data type is DWORD*. |
TI_GET_SYMNAME The symbol name. The data type is WCHAR**. The caller must free the buffer. |
TI_GET_LENGTH The length of the type. The data type is ULONG64*. |
TI_GET_TYPE The type. The data type is DWORD*. |
TI_GET_TYPEID The type index. The data type is DWORD*. |
TI_GET_BASETYPE The base type for the type index. The data type is DWORD*. |
TI_GET_ARRAYINDEXTYPEID The type index for index of an array type. The data type is DWORD*. |
TI_FINDCHILDREN The type index of all children. The data type is a pointer to a TI_FINDCHILDREN_PARAMS structure. - The Count member should be initialized with the number of children. - The Start member should also be initialized. In most cases, to zero. |
TI_GET_DATAKIND The data kind. The data type is DWORD*. |
TI_GET_ADDRESSOFFSET The address offset. The data type is DWORD*. |
TI_GET_OFFSET The offset of the type in the parent. Members can use this to get their offset in a structure. The data type is DWORD*. |
TI_GET_VALUE The value of a constant or enumeration value. The data type is VARIANT*. |
TI_GET_COUNT The count of array elements. The data type is DWORD*. |
TI_GET_CHILDRENCOUNT The number of children. The data type is DWORD*. |
TI_GET_BITPOSITION The bit position of a bitfield. The data type is DWORD*. |
TI_GET_VIRTUALBASECLASS A value that indicates whether the base class is virtually inherited. The data type is BOOL. |
TI_GET_VIRTUALTABLESHAPEID The symbol interface of the type of virtual table, for a user-defined type. |
TI_GET_VIRTUALBASEPOINTEROFFSET The offset of the virtual base pointer. The data type is DWORD*. |
TI_GET_CLASSPARENTID The type index of the class parent. The data type is DWORD*. |
TI_GET_NESTED A value that indicates whether the type index is nested. The data type is DWORD*. |
TI_GET_SYMINDEX The symbol index for a type. The data type is DWORD*. |
TI_GET_LEXICALPARENT The lexical parent of the type. The data type is DWORD*. |
TI_GET_ADDRESS The index address. The data type is ULONG64*. |
TI_GET_THISADJUST The offset from the this pointer to its actual value. The data type is DWORD*. |
TI_GET_UDTKIND The UDT kind. The data type is DWORD*. |
TI_IS_EQUIV_TO The equivalency of two types. The data type is DWORD*. The value is S_OK is the two types are equivalent, and S_FALSE otherwise. |
TI_GET_CALLING_CONVENTION The calling convention. The data type is DWORD. The following are the valid values: |
TI_IS_CLOSE_EQUIV_TO The equivalency of two symbols. This is not guaranteed to be accurate. The data type is DWORD*. The value is S_OK is the two types are equivalent, and S_FALSE otherwise. |
TI_GTIEX_REQS_VALID The element where the valid request bitfield should be stored. The data type is ULONG64*. This value is only used with the SymGetTypeInfoEx function. |
TI_GET_VIRTUALBASEOFFSET The offset in the virtual function table of a virtual function. The data type is DWORD. |
TI_GET_VIRTUALBASEDISPINDEX The index into the virtual base displacement table. The data type is DWORD. |
TI_GET_IS_REFERENCE Indicates whether a pointer type is a reference. The data type is Boolean. |
TI_GET_INDIRECTVIRTUALBASECLASS Indicates whether the user-defined data type is an indirect virtual base. The data type is BOOL. DbgHelp 6.6 and earlier: This value is not supported. |

Requirements
Header | dbghelp.h |
Redistributable | DbgHelp.dll 5.1 or later |
